Comparison of specifications

In the specification comparison table, the processor release date and overclocking capability will be the most useful. The newer the processor, the longer it will last in your computer. And the easier it will be to upgrade the system in the future. The same benefits from the presence of overclocking. If the processor can be overclocked, increasing its performance, then it will still be able to produce maximum FPS in new games. It turns out that there is no longer a need to buy a new CPU to enjoy the games any longer. The savings are obvious!

AMD EPYC 7662 AMD EPYC 7F72
Announcement dateOctober 01, 2020April 14, 2020
TypeServerServer
SocketSP3SP3
Core nameRomeRome
ArchitectureZen 2Zen 2
Generation22
Turbo Frequency3.3 MHz3.7 MHz
Frequency2 MHz3.2 MHz
Cores6424
Threads12848
Bus rate
Bit6464
Lithography7 nm7 nm
Transistors count64000 millions62000 millions
Power consumption (TDP)225 W240 W
Memory typeDDR4DDR4
Max. Memory4096 Gb
Memory Frequency32003200
Memory bandwidth208 GByte/s204.8 GB/s
L1 cache
L2 cache
L3 cache256MB192MB
OverclockingNoNo
Supports ECCNoNo
Part number100-000000137
100-000000137WOF
100-000000141
100-000000141WOF
In this comparison block, you should pay attention to the differences in clock speed and the number of cores. Here EPYC 7F72 is 37% better than EPYC 7662 in terms of CPU frequency. Another difference is that EPYC 7662 has 40 more core than EPYC 7F72. Also keep in mind that high CPU frequency affects battery life through power consumption (relevant for laptops).
